Analysis

AIMS: East Asia recorded 97.94 million for school age population, primary education, male in 2024.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.3% on the previous year and up 7.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, school age population, primary education, male in AIMS: East Asia peaked at 106.69 million in 1998 and was at its lowest, 72.08 million, in 1970.

AIMS: East Asia ranks 40th of 221 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.

School age population, primary education, male in AIMS: East Asia, year by year

Annual values for School age population, primary education, male (number) in AIMS: East Asia, 1970 to 2024.
Year Value Change
1970 72.08 million
1971 77.89 million +8.1%
1972 84.01 million +7.9%
1973 90.41 million +7.6%
1974 96.82 million +7.1%
1975 97.89 million +1.1%
1976 97.95 million +0.1%
1977 99.11 million +1.2%
1978 100.57 million +1.5%
1979 101.62 million +1.0%
1980 102.92 million +1.3%
1981 101.89 million -1.0%
1982 100.18 million -1.7%
1983 96.98 million -3.2%
1984 94.06 million -3.0%
1985 90.83 million -3.4%
1986 88.08 million -3.0%
1987 86.73 million -1.5%
1988 86.84 million +0.1%
1989 87.84 million +1.2%
1990 90.56 million +3.1%
1991 92.00 million +1.6%
1992 93.47 million +1.6%
1993 95.12 million +1.8%
1994 97.16 million +2.2%
1995 99.08 million +2.0%
1996 101.76 million +2.7%
1997 104.25 million +2.4%
1998 106.69 million +2.3%
1999 105.43 million -1.2%
2000 102.62 million -2.7%
2001 99.86 million -2.7%
2002 96.27 million -3.6%
2003 91.87 million -4.6%
2004 98.83 million +7.6%
2005 96.88 million -2.0%
2006 95.20 million -1.7%
2007 94.25 million -1.0%
2008 93.01 million -1.3%
2009 91.99 million -1.1%
2010 91.32 million -0.7%
2011 90.71 million -0.7%
2012 90.53 million -0.2%
2013 90.30 million -0.2%
2014 91.10 million +0.9%
2015 92.12 million +1.1%
2016 93.27 million +1.3%
2017 94.28 million +1.1%
2018 95.26 million +1.0%
2019 96.92 million +1.7%
2020 97.72 million +0.8%
2021 98.35 million +0.6%
2022 98.17 million -0.2%
2023 98.19 million +0.0%
2024 97.94 million -0.3%
